Browse Source

fix: select高度2

master
guoapeng 2 weeks ago
parent
commit
c820aabdfd
  1. 8
      src/components/formula/FormulaConfig.vue
  2. 2
      src/components/formula/HomeFormulaConfig.vue
  3. 2
      src/components/formula/RunFormulaConfig.vue
  4. 5
      src/components/formula/SettingFormulaConfig.vue

8
src/components/formula/FormulaConfig.vue

@ -273,13 +273,7 @@ const validateName = (rule: any, value: any, callback: any) => {
</ft-input> </ft-input>
</template> </template>
<template v-else-if="item.val_type === 'enum'"> <template v-else-if="item.val_type === 'enum'">
<el-select
v-model="formData[item.setting_id]"
v-prevent-keyboard
style="width: 80%"
placeholder="请选择"
readonly
>
<el-select v-model="formData[item.setting_id]" style="width: 80%" placeholder="请选择" readonly>
<el-option v-for="log in item.enums" :key="log" :label="log" :value="log" /> <el-option v-for="log in item.enums" :key="log" :label="log" :value="log" />
</el-select> </el-select>
</template> </template>

2
src/components/formula/HomeFormulaConfig.vue

@ -84,7 +84,7 @@ const size = 'default'
</ft-input> </ft-input>
</template> </template>
<template v-else-if="item.val_type === 'enum'"> <template v-else-if="item.val_type === 'enum'">
<el-select v-model="formData[item.setting_id]" style="width: 80%; height: 40px" placeholder="请选择" readonly>
<el-select v-model="formData[item.setting_id]" style="width: 80%" placeholder="请选择" readonly>
<el-option v-for="log in item.enums" :key="log" :label="log" :value="log" /> <el-option v-for="log in item.enums" :key="log" :label="log" :value="log" />
</el-select> </el-select>
</template> </template>

2
src/components/formula/RunFormulaConfig.vue

@ -107,7 +107,7 @@ const validatePass = (rule: any, value: any, callback: any, config: Formula.Form
<el-select <el-select
v-model="formData[item.setting_id]" v-model="formData[item.setting_id]"
v-prevent-keyboard v-prevent-keyboard
style="width: 80%; height: 40px"
style="width: 80%"
placeholder="请选择" placeholder="请选择"
:disabled="!item.is_editable" :disabled="!item.is_editable"
readonly readonly

5
src/components/formula/SettingFormulaConfig.vue

@ -137,7 +137,7 @@ const validatePass = (rule: any, value: any, callback: any, config: Formula.Form
<el-select <el-select
v-model="formData[item.setting_id]" v-model="formData[item.setting_id]"
v-prevent-keyboard v-prevent-keyboard
style="width: 80%; height: 40px"
style="width: 80%"
placeholder="请选择" placeholder="请选择"
readonly readonly
> >
@ -185,6 +185,9 @@ const validatePass = (rule: any, value: any, callback: any, config: Formula.Form
text-align: left; text-align: left;
height: 40px; height: 40px;
} }
:deep(.el-select) {
height: 42px;
}
:deep(.el-select__wrapper) { :deep(.el-select__wrapper) {
height: 42px; height: 42px;
} }

Loading…
Cancel
Save